To solve the given problems, we need to carefully handle the subtraction of integers, keeping in mind the rules for subtracting positive and negative numbers. Here are the solutions step by step:
1. Subtracting a negative number is the same as adding its positive counterpart.
- \( a - (-b) = a + b \)
2. Subtracting a positive number is straightforward.
- \( a - b = a - b \)
#### 1) \( (-13) - (-5) \)
- Subtracting a negative is the same as adding its positive counterpart.
- \( (-13) - (-5) = (-13) + 5 = -8 \)
- Answer: \(-8\)
#### 2) \( (-9) - 16 \)
- Subtracting a positive number is straightforward.
- \( (-9) - 16 = -9 - 16 = -25 \)
- Answer: \(-25\)
#### 3) \( 7 - (-11) \)
- Subtracting a negative is the same as adding its positive counterpart.
- \( 7 - (-11) = 7 + 11 = 18 \)
- Answer: \(18\)
#### 4) \( 20 - 3 \)
- Subtracting a positive number is straightforward.
- \( 20 - 3 = 17 \)
- Answer: \(17\)
#### 5) \( (-18) - 14 \)
- Subtracting a positive number is straightforward.
- \( (-18) - 14 = -18 - 14 = -32 \)
- Answer: \(-32\)
#### 6) \( (-10) - (-10) \)
- Subtracting a negative is the same as adding its positive counterpart.
- \( (-10) - (-10) = (-10) + 10 = 0 \)
- Answer: \(0\)
#### 7) \( 15 - 2 \)
- Subtracting a positive number is straightforward.
- \( 15 - 2 = 13 \)
- Answer: \(13\)
#### 8) \( 8 - (-12) \)
- Subtracting a negative is the same as adding its positive counterpart.
- \( 8 - (-12) = 8 + 12 = 20 \)
- Answer: \(20\)
#### 9) \( (-20) - 9 \)
- Subtracting a positive number is straightforward.
- \( (-20) - 9 = -20 - 9 = -29 \)
- Answer: \(-29\)
#### 10) \( 17 - 6 \)
- Subtracting a positive number is straightforward.
- \( 17 - 6 = 11 \)
- Answer: \(11\)
#### 11) \( (-8) - (-14) \)
- Subtracting a negative is the same as adding its positive counterpart.
- \( (-8) - (-14) = (-8) + 14 = 6 \)
- Answer: \(6\)
#### 12) \( 12 - (-3) \)
- Subtracting a negative is the same as adding its positive counterpart.
- \( 12 - (-3) = 12 + 3 = 15 \)
- Answer: \(15\)
#### 13) \( 5 - 19 \)
- Subtracting a positive number is straightforward.
- \( 5 - 19 = -14 \)
- Answer: \(-14\)
#### 14) \( (-16) - 10 \)
- Subtracting a positive number is straightforward.
- \( (-16) - 10 = -16 - 10 = -26 \)
- Answer: \(-26\)
#### 15) \( 18 - (-4) \)
- Subtracting a negative is the same as adding its positive counterpart.
- \( 18 - (-4) = 18 + 4 = 22 \)
- Answer: \(22\)
#### 16) \( (-17) - (-1) \)
- Subtracting a negative is the same as adding its positive counterpart.
- \( (-17) - (-1) = (-17) + 1 = -16 \)
- Answer: \(-16\)
